Job Description

Amazon Leo is an initiative to increase global broadband access through a constellation of satellites in low Earth orbit (LEO). Its mission is to bring fast, affordable broadband to unserved and underserved communities around the world. Amazon Leo will help close the digital divide by delivering fast, affordable broadband to a wide range of customers, including consumers, businesses, government agencies, and other organizations operating in places without reliable connectivity. Our team tackles secure communication between critical satellite functions. We are looking for a Senior Software Engineer to participate in all phases of software development from requirements through implementation and test to operations. As a Sr. Engineer you will engage with an experienced cross-disciplinary staff to conceive and design solutions. You must be responsive, flexible, and able to succeed within an open, collaborative peer environment. You will participate in the design, integration and improvement of the SW. This includes designing and implementing a wide range of low-level embedded software on our hardware services, including device drivers, Linux kernel modules, porting existing software to new embedded systems, and other low level programming activities.
